Despite a fine individual performance Liverpool keeper Scott Carson saw his hopes of playing in the Under-21 European Championship ended this evening.

Starting in goal for England in the second leg of the two match play-off against their French counterparts Carson played well pulling off one exceptional save in particular from club mate Anthony LeTallec. However despite taking the lead, which gave them a 2-1 advantage overall England could not hold on. Carson was close to saving both goals and could not be blamed for his sides failure to go through.

The result is the second blow to Carson's progress in the space of a few weeks. With Liverpool also crashing out of the Carling Cup, a competition Carson would have featured heavily in, the young keeper will now have to bide his time for further opportunities.

The interest for Liverpool in this competition will now be focused on Anthony LeTallec who is currently on loan at Sunderland. Having arrived with a growing reputation the attacking player has yet to establish himself. There is uncertainty as to whether the player has a future at Anfield, but impressing with the French Under 21 side will help his chances.
